Editorial overview Touché

Read and Speak Arabic for Beginners, Third Edition by Mahmoud Gaafar, published by McGraw-Hill Education on October 20, 2017, is a practical resource designed to help learners communicate effectively in Arabic. This 96-page edition provides an engaging program that addresses the challenges of learning a language with a non-Roman script. It covers essential topics such as self-introduction, asking for directions, and discussing family and places, making it suitable for everyday communication.

Readers will find a variety of tools to enhance their learning experience, including vocabulary flashcards, quizzes, and audio resources accessible through the McGraw-Hill Language Lab app. The book employs a two-color layout and includes photographs to illustrate key vocabulary, alongside games and puzzles that reinforce language skills. This edition aims to support learners in developing their communication abilities through structured practice and interactive activities, making it a comprehensive guide for those beginning their journey in Arabic language study.
